Topins Grove
Hamlet
Topins Grove is an unincorporated community in Jackson County, West Virginia, United States. Topins Grove is located on Little Pond Creek and County Highway 6, 7.7 miles north-northeast of Ravenswood. Topins Grove once had a post office, which is now closed.
Lone Cedar
Hamlet
Lone Cedar is an unincorporated community in Jackson County, West Virginia, United States. The community was named for an individual cedar tree near the original town site. Lone Cedar is situated 2½ miles northwest of Lamps Cemetery.
